Abstract

ObjectiveTo define the relationship of tumor size with surgico-pathological factors and oncological outcome in FIGO 2014 stage IB cervical cancer. MethodsThis study retrospectively evaluated 384 FIGO 2014 Stage IB cervical cancer patients who underwent radical hysterectomy and lymphadenectomy. Tumor size was stratified according to 2 cm (≤ 2cm, 2-≤4 cm, >4 cm) and 4 cm (≤4 cm, >4 cm), and the relationship with poor prognostic factors, and the effects on survival were examined. The distribution of prognostic factors was compared between three subgroups: ≤2 cm vs. 2-≤4 cm; 2-≤4 cm vs. > 4 cm and ≤ 2 cm vs. > 4 cm. Survival rate was evaluated using the Kaplan–Meier method and compared with the log-rank test. Multivariate analysis was performed using Cox proportional-hazards regression. ResultsStratification of tumor size according to 4 cm was found to better determine pelvic lymph node determination. Parametrial involvement, uterine involvement and deep cervical stromal invasion were correlated with increasing tumor size. Lymph node involvement and uterine involvement were an independent prognostic risk factor for recurrence and cancer-specific survival. Tumor size showed no association with prognosis. ConclusionThere is no meaningful cut-off value for tumor size determining all surgico-pathological factors. There was also seen to be no association between tumor size and recurrence or disease-related mortality.
